Pergola painting services involve applying fresh paint or stain to the wooden or metal structures of a pergola, enhancing both its appearance and durability. This process typically includes cleaning the surface to remove dirt, mold, or old paint, followed by sanding or prepping the material to ensure proper adhesion. Once prepared, a professional contractor applies high-quality paint or stain designed to withstand outdoor elements, helping the pergola maintain its aesthetic appeal and structural integrity over time.

This service addresses common issues such as peeling, fading, or cracking of existing paint, which can compromise the visual appeal and protection of the pergola. Over time, exposure to sun, rain, and temperature fluctuations can cause wood to warp or metal to corrode, leading to costly repairs if not properly maintained. Pergola painting provides a protective layer that helps prevent weather-related damage, extends the lifespan of the structure, and refreshes the outdoor space with a clean, polished look.

The overview below groups typical Pergola Painting proj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Basic touch-ups and minor repainting of a pergola typ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ine maintenance jobs fall within this range, depending on the size and condition of the structure.

Standard Repainting - Repainting an entire pergola with a single color usually ranges from $600 to $1,500. Most projects of this scope are priced within this band, with fewer reaching higher costs for additional prep work.

Color Changes and Custom Finishes - Changing colors or applying custom finishes can increase costs to between $1,500 and $3,000. Larger or more detailed projects tend to fall into this range, though some complex jobs can go higher.

Full Replacement or Extensive Restoration - Complete pergola replacement or extensive restoration projects often cost $3,000 to $5,000 or more. Such projects are less common and typically involve significant structural work or custom design elements.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of paint are suitable for pergola surfaces? Local contractors often recommend exterior-grade paints designed for wood or metal, depending on the pergola's material, to ensure durability and weather resistance.

Can pergola painting help protect the structure from weather damage? Yes, applying high-quality paint can provide a protective barrier against moisture, UV rays, and other environmental elements that may cause deterioration.

Is it necessary to prepare the pergola before painting? Proper preparation, such as cleaning and sanding the surface, is typically advised by local service providers to ensure optimal paint adhesion and a smooth finish.

What finishes are available for pergola painting? Local pros can apply various finishes, including matte, satin, or semi-gloss, to achieve different aesthetic effects and levels of sheen.
